January 2014:
Hair & Wigs – Style a wig, hairpiece, or your own hair into a historical style to suit your outfit.

February 2014:
Jewelry – Bling it up! Add some sparkle to your ensemble with necklaces, bracelets, earrings, brooches, & more.

March 2014:
Gloves & Mitts – Elegant or practical hand coverings have been used across time.

You can always check the main Accessory Challenge page for updates & details on how to play along, who’s participating, & more.

I’m excited about these three challenges because they’re some of the most fun things to make! Hair & wigs can seem hard, but once you get started, you’ll find they’re very satisfying & rewarding. Jewelry is dead easy to make, it can be amazingly inexpensive compared to stuff you buy pre-assembled, & you can turn out things that look spectacularly historically accurate. And gloves or mitts, well, those can be as complicated or as easy as you want — feel free to start with vintage gloves & deck them out, it’s a fabulous way to get a period look too.
